In the pantheon of handheld gaming, few titles carry the weight of mystery and fan-driven passion as Final Fantasy Type-0. Originally released exclusively in Japan for the PlayStation Portable (PSP) in 2011, this ambitious action-RPG was a commercial and critical hit in its home country. However, for Western fans, Square Enix remained silent for years. The game was considered too large, too complex, and too late in the PSP’s life cycle to localize. Even the v2 patch isn’t 100% bug-free:
| Issue | Workaround |
|-------|-------------|
| Minor text clipping in long item descriptions | Ignore; no functional impact |
| Rare freeze after certain cutscenes on real PSP | Switch to PPSSPP for that section, or disable “fast memory” in CFW |
| Some NPC names differ from HD remaster | Intended – v2 uses original fan translation choices |
| Merged ISO may hang on “Now Loading” | Re-merge using a different tool (try PSP ISO Combiner v1.4) |
